Duties of Partners to the Partnership and each other:
RUPA says that Partners owes to the partnerships and to each other the highest degree of loyalty. And
they must act consistently with the obligation of good faith and fair dealing.
Mean (Partners have trust relationship not only to the partners but due to the other partners.)
General duties that are going to be owned including:
DUTY to Serve:
Duty of Care: Each partner owes a duty of care. A partner is not liable to the partnership for partner’s
honest errors. Such as negligence. But a partner is liable for losses resulting from gross negligence,
intentional misconduct, reckless conduct, or a knowing of violation of the law.
Duty to act within actual Authority: Duty to avoid interest that is adverse to the partnership: Duty to
disclose material information: duty to maintain confidentiality of partnership information.
